Team, the Lendery catalogue import moved to the new Stackfeed pipeline last night. All 214k records from the legacy Shelfmark dump were ingested; the delta job now runs nightly instead of weekly. Duplicate-detection thresholds were loosened slightly after the dry run flagged too many false positives on serials. The old importer remains readable for thirty days, then gets decommissioned. If you need to re-run a batch, use the replay command, not a fresh import. The pipeline currently runs with the following configuration.

service settings:
[casax]
port = 6379
team = rusir
host = casax.zemvarhq.corp
region = outer-4
access_code = ac_9808ce
timeout_ms = 1500

## CI Troubleshooting: Stale Cache in Plugin Builds

Following the Fernwick stale-cache incident, the Loomhaven CI runners now key plugin caches on a combined hash of the lockfile and the plugin manifest version. If your plugin picks up outdated dependencies, confirm you bumped the manifest version — a lockfile-only change no longer invalidates the cache by itself. Clearing caches manually is rarely needed and should be a last resort. When filing a report, include the trace token printed below your build summary.

trace token, fawig-fawef: htk3_0ee

# vramscope profiling config — please review carefully.
# This env drives the Ostermere vramscope daemon, which samples GPU
# memory allocations every 50ms and writes flamegraphs to /var/vramscope.
# VS_SAMPLE_RATE and VS_DEVICE_MASK are set per the staging defaults;
# flag anything that diverges. The collector endpoint requires an
# authentication credential, which is set on the following line:

env line for fafof-fahag: LEDGER_TOKEN5=f8790

Snapshot tests for Glintworks UI components live next to each component file. Run the suite before every push. If a snapshot changes, review the diff — never blindly update. Intentional visual changes need a note in the PR description. Flaky snapshots usually mean unmocked dates or random IDs. Conventions, update commands, and the approval checklist are on the internal page.

runbook for badug-kadup: https://confluence.zemvarlabs.internal/projects/browse/display/projects/bd1b